What is Stampcoat?
Based in El Paso, Texas, Stampcoat operates as a comprehensive provider of metal fabrication, precision stamping, and industrial-grade powder coating services. With a legacy spanning over five decades, the firm has cultivated a reputation for reliability across critical sectors, including automotive and electronics manufacturing. The company distinguishes itself through ISO 9001 certified processes, which ensure that every component—from initial prototype development to high-volume production runs—meets rigorous quality standards. By integrating fabrication and assembly under one roof, Stampcoat provides a streamlined, end-to-end solution for clients requiring durable, high-performance finishes and complex metal parts.
